Official record

Development description

Change of use of existing retail premises for use as residential, full planning permission is sought to partially demolish existing building and permission is sought to renovate and extend existing building to include 2 no. Additional floors to accommodate 8 no. Apartments in total comprising of 6 no. 2 bedroom apartments and 2 no. 1 bedroom apartments, all ancillary site works and services.
